| Description | The password reset funcionality is vulnerable to unauthorized account modification due to improper validation of the user_id parameter. An attacker can manipulate this predictable numeric identifier to reset passwords for arbitrary users without proving account ownership. | |
| Title | Weak password recovery mechanism for forgotten password in MobiAPParc | |
